Calculate the radiative heat transfer (in watts to 1 d.p) from a sphere of diameter 500 mm having a surface temperature of 80°C located in a room at 28°C. Given: o=56.7 x 10-9 W/(m²K4) Emissivity of surface = 0.7 = Surface area sphere = nd? = DO NOT INCLUDE UNITS
